The Latest Buzz Around Dogecoin225
Dogecoin, the cryptocurrency that started as a joke, has recently seen a surge in popularity. In the past few months, its value has skyrocketed, making it one of the most talked-about cryptocurrencies in the world. But what's behind this sudden rise in interest? And what does it mean for the future of Dogecoin?
There are a few factors that have contributed to Dogecoin's recent surge in popularity. One is the growing interest in cryptocurrency in general. As more people learn about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ies, they are starting to see the potential of Dogecoin as a way to invest or make money.
Another factor is the support of Elon Musk. The Tesla and SpaceX CEO has been a vocal supporter of Dogecoin on Twitter, and his tweets have helped to raise its profile. In May, Musk even said that he would accept Dogecoin as payment for Tesla cars.
Finally, Dogecoin has benefited from the rise of meme culture. The cryptocurrency has been featured in numerous memes and online jokes, which has helped to spread awareness of it. This has led to a growing number of people buying Dogecoin simply because it's fun and trendy.
The surge in popularity has had a number of positive effects on Dogecoin. Its value has increased significantly, and it is now one of the most valuable cryptocurrencies in the world. This has made it more attractive to investors and traders, and it has also led to a number of new businesses accepting Dogecoin as payment.
However, the rise in popularity has also brought some challenges. One is the volatility of Dogecoin's price. Its value has fluctuated wildly in recent months, and this could make it a risky investment for some people.
Another challenge is the lack of regulation surrounding Dogecoin. Unlike Bitcoin and other major cryptocurrencies, Dogecoin is not regulated by any government or financial institution. This means that there is no guarantee that its value will continue to rise, and it could be vulnerable to manipulation.
